4-star Georgian manor in Salisbury

Location

Milford Hall Hotel is located a short walk from the Cathedral City Centre of Salisbury and within driving distance of the world-famous Stonehenge. The hotel offers easy access to the historic market square, local shops, and cultural attractions such as the Salisbury Playhouse. Guests can explore the beautiful countryside of Wiltshire, making it a convenient base for discovering nearby landmarks.

Rooms

The hotel features 45 luxurious bedrooms, each individually furnished with a blend of traditional and contemporary styles. Select rooms include four-poster beds, ornate fireplaces, and freestanding baths, providing a unique touch to each stay. Modern extension rooms come equipped with flat-screen TVs and en-suite facilities to offer a comfortable experience for all guests.

Dining

Sarums Brasserie & Bar serves high-quality Italian cuisine crafted from locally-sourced ingredients. The menu offers wood-fired pizzas and seasonal dishes, providing a diverse dining experience. Guests can also enjoy afternoon tea with a variety of finger sandwiches and pastries in a relaxed atmosphere.

Weddings and Events

The hotel provides versatile event spaces, including the Alderman Suite, accommodating up to 150 guests for weddings and special occasions. Each venue is licensed for civil ceremonies, allowing couples to celebrate their special day on-site. Expert event coordinators assist with planning, ensuring a seamless experience for all gatherings.

Activities and Attractions

Milford Hall Hotel offers easy access to various attractions, including Salisbury Cathedral, the historic Old Sarum, and the Salisbury Charter Market. Guests can explore the nearby New Forest for outdoor activities such as hiking and horseback riding. The hotel also organizes special packages, including afternoon teas and culinary events to enhance guest experiences.

Salisbury Cathedral and Magna Carta
Salisbury Cathedral and Magna Carta
15 minutes' walk
This iconic cathedral houses the original Magna Carta and features stunning Gothic architecture and a beautiful spire.
Mompesson House
Mompesson House
12 minutes' walk
An 18th-century house with exquisite gardens and interiors showcasing period furniture, perfect for history enthusiasts.
The Salisbury Museum
The Salisbury Museum
16 minutes' walk
Home to a rich collection of local artifacts, the museum hosts engaging exhibitions about the history of Salisbury.
Old Sarum
Old Sarum
25 minutes' walk
An ancient hilltop fort with panoramic views, offering insights into the region's history and archaeological significance.

Superb Hotel Experience!

helpful staff convenient parking
The staff was helpful. I found convenient parking! The ground floor rooms provided easy disabled access. Food was very good.
The room felt uncomfortably warm upon arrival. There was no working AC in the room. Bathrobes and shower caps were absent from the bathroom.
Rooms
9/10
The Premium Twin Room had a stylish decoration with perfect temperature during the night. The room's layout and furniture were amazing! It was a good-sized room. A lovely shower existed.
Facilities
8/10
Ease of access from the road network was noticeable! The hotel provided convenient parking. Helpful staff responded quickly to needs. Ground floor rooms had disabled access. This was great.
Dining
10/10
The breakfast was delicious. The hotel provided a good range of ground floor rooms. This was great. I found the responsive staff helpful. The food was very good.
